Burkholderia pseudomallei Survival in Lung Epithelial Cells Benefits from miRNA-Mediated Suppression of ATG10 Based on microarray screening, scientists found that ATG10 was downregulated following B. pseudomallei infection in A549 human lung epithelial cells. Forced expression of ATG10 accelerated the elimination of intracellular B. pseudomallei by enhancing the process of autophagy. [Environ Toxicol] Abstract LUNG CANCER RhoB Loss Induces Rac1-Dependent Mesenchymal Cell Invasion in Lung Cells through PP2A Inhibition Scientists identified the small GTPase RhoB as a key regulator of bronchial cell morphology in a three-dimensional (3D) matrix. RhoB loss, which is frequently observed during lung cancer progression, induced an epithelial-mesenchymal transition characterized by an increased proportion of invasive elongated cells in 3D.
